Holomorphic differential locus conjecture
Let be a partition of with non-negative parts. For sufficiently large , let be the resulting polynomial in , and let denote the closure of the locus of holomorphic differentials with zero orders . Holomorphic differential locus conjecture.
This predicts that the class of the compactified holomorphic-differential locus is obtained from the constant term of the polynomial extension of Witten's -spin class. The claim has been proved by A. Sauvaget, so it is no longer open.
